Adeleke wins Osun. But what next for Accord?
The Accord Party’s victory in Osun has created a new opportunity for the relatively small party to expand its influence ahead of 2027, but its continuing leadership dispute presents a major challenge to consolidating the gains from Adeleke’s re-election.
